What is Car Reprogramming?
Car reprogramming, often described as ECU remapping or tuning, involves changing the software that controls your vehicle's engine and other critical systems. By adjusting specifications such as fuel mix, air consumption, and timing, reprogramming can enhance efficiency and enhance fuel performance. This service is typically searched for for factors including:
Performance Enhancement: Drivers trying to find improved acceleration and overall power.Fuel Economy: Adjusting settings to make it possible for much better fuel efficiency.Troubleshooting: Diagnosing and fixing efficiency issues, such as poor fuel economy or reduced power.Modification: Modifying vehicle settings to fit individual preferences or for particular driving conditions.Advantages of Car Reprogramming

Motorists may look for reprogramming for numerous reasons, consisting of:
Aftermarket Modifications: Upgrades like turbochargers or cold air consumption typically necessitate ECU modifications for optimum performance.Vehicle Repair: If an ECU failure occurs or components are replaced, reprogramming might be required.Enhanced Safety Features: Some newer models have actually advanced security features that need software updates for enhanced performance.Efficiency Tuning: Car lovers might desire a more responsive engine or enhanced handling qualities.Finding Car Reprogramming Services Near You

FAQs About Car ReprogrammingQ1: How long does the reprogramming process normally take?
Response: The period differs based on the complexity of the reprogramming but typically lasts in between one to 3 hours.
Q2: Will reprogramming void my vehicle's guarantee?
Response: It can potentially void your service warranty, particularly if modifications are comprehensive. It's advisable to consult your vehicle's warranty terms or consult with the dealer prior to reprogramming.
Q3: Is car reprogramming unlawful?
Answer: Car reprogramming itself is legal, however modifying emissions-related setups to prevent regulations is illegal. Make sure compliance with regional laws.
Q4: Can I perform reprogramming myself?
Response: While some users may have the technical skills and tools to carry out DIY remapping, it is usually advised to look for expert services to avoid prospective damage to the ECU.
